    Harvey S.

    Stopped by for a bite before hitting the bars and wow, this place is legit. We got the bossam (steamed pork) and the potato pancakes. Both were giant portions and delicious. The banchan was super fresh and delicious. Was enough food to feed 4-5 people. Wish we lived closer, would be here all the time to try other menu items.

    Ariel L.

    I was craving soup at night and found this spot open late. So happy I tried this spot! The soup here is soo good! We got the beef soup with brisket & the rice cake and dumpling soup. They have one of the best beef soups I've had. The broth is soo flavorful & the brisket is tender. The banchan was also really yummy. The worker was super nice & I loved how clean the restaurant is.

    Doli O.

    - Bean sprouts were perfectly seasoned. - Kimchi was good, but a little too salty. - Seafood pancake was soft, crispy, not dry, packed with seafood, perfectly seasoned. - Bossam had thicker cuts than I was used to, but was still decent. - Water tasted good.     You know you're at a legitimate Korean restaurant when all the waitstaff is hardworking Korean…read moreaunties. The menu seems bit limited but it actually covers a wide variety of Korean food: boiling hot soups, cold noodles, something fried, and something with rice! Portions are huge and they give you three types of kimchi that taste house-made. My favorite here is the NakJi Dol-Sot.

    I've been coming here for many, many, many years. Am I a fan of this place? YES! Do I love the…read morefood? YES! Does the food taste great? YES Is the place clean? Yes. Is the service good? NO! Are the servers nice? NO! Is the price decent? NO! Here's my reasoning: I used to bring my grandfather here because he loved their soup. If I didn't bring him I would buy the galbi tang and take it to him. And back then the service was amazing, the ajummas were so nice and would get you extra servings of banchan and brisket sauce but sadly throughout the years they've become very stingy and just plain out rude. I understand the cost of inflation and it's very real but I used to get their galbi tang for less than $10. At this rate it's costing me $27 for a bowl of soup and no extra gimme with not even a smile. Will I still be back? Yes but not like before. With the competition out here there are other places to go but I do keep coming back. Oh what's a girl to do. Will I recommend this place? That's a hard NO.
